Ancient Egypt has always fascinated people of all ages with its rich history, captivating mythology, and awe-inspiring monuments. This mystical land has left an indelible mark on our understanding of human civilization. It's no wonder that children, in particular, are drawn to the mysteries of Ancient Egypt. To engage young minds and foster a love for history, we present you with the best sellers that bring Ancient Egypt to life for children. Here are some remarkable books that will take your child on an engrossing journey into the past.

1. "The Pharaoh's Secret" by Marissa Moss

[view image]

In "The Pharaoh's Secret," Marissa Moss weaves an enchanting story set in Ancient Egypt. The book follows the adventures of Talibah, a young girl who stumbles upon an ancient artifact that holds a secret. As Talibah embarks on a quest to uncover the truth, readers are transported to the fascinating world of pharaohs, pyramids, and hieroglyphics.

This vividly illustrated book offers a captivating blend of fact and fiction. Young readers will be captivated by the vivid descriptions of daily life in Ancient Egypt and intrigued by the mysteries surrounding the artifact. Perfect for children aged 8 and above, "The Pharaoh's Secret" is a must-read for both history enthusiasts and adventure seekers.

2. "Egyptology: Search for the Tomb of Osiris" by Dugald A. Steer

[view image]

For budding archaeologists eager to dive into the world of Ancient Egypt, "Egyptology: Search for the Tomb of Osiris" is an absolute treasure. This interactive book takes children on an adventurous quest to find the lost tomb of the god Osiris.

With its stunning illustrations, lift-the-flaps, and pull-out facsimile documents, "Egyptology" provides an engaging and immersive experience for young readers. The book introduces kids to the fascinating rituals, beliefs, and mythology of Ancient Egypt in an entertaining and educational way. Recommended for children aged 10 and above, this book promises hours of exploration and discovery.

3. "Mummies in the Morning" (Magic Tree House #3) by Mary Pope Osborne

[view image]

"Mummies in the Morning" is part of the popular "Magic Tree House" series by Mary Pope Osborne. This enchanting time-travel adventure takes readers on a journey to Ancient Egypt with siblings Jack and Annie.

In this action-packed page-turner, Jack and Annie must help a ghost named "Kwackenbush" find his way home. Through their incredible journey, youngsters will learn about the significance of the pyramids, the process of mummification, and the magic of Ancient Egypt. With its engaging narrative and relatable characters, this book is suitable for children aged 7 and above.

4. "The Cat of Bubastes: A Tale of Ancient Egypt" by G. A. Henty

[view image]

G. A. Henty's "The Cat of Bubastes" is a gripping historical fiction set against the backdrop of Ancient Egypt. The story revolves around a young prince named Amuba, who becomes a slave after being captured by an invading army. As the plot unfolds, readers are taken on a thrilling journey of friendship, betrayal, and redemption.

This well-researched book provides valuable insights into the history, culture, and religious practices of Ancient Egypt. With its vivid descriptions and compelling narrative, "The Cat of Bubastes" offers an immersive experience for young readers interested in this era. Recommended for children aged 12 and above, this book ensures an unforgettable reading experience.

5. "You Wouldn't Want to Be an Egyptian Mummy!" by David Stewart

[view image]

"You Wouldn't Want to Be an Egyptian Mummy!" is an amusing and educational book that allows children to explore the intriguing world of mummification. Through a lively and humorous narrative, young readers will discover the meticulous process of mummification and the beliefs surrounding the afterlife in Ancient Egypt.

This captivating book engages children with its interactive features, such as pop-up illustrations, humorous illustrations, and quirky facts. Suitable for kids aged 8 and above, "You Wouldn't Want to Be an Egyptian Mummy!" offers an entertaining way to learn about Ancient Egypt's funerary traditions.

With these best-selling books about Ancient Egypt history, children can embark on a voyage of discovery. Whether they're fascinated by the pyramids, intrigued by mummies, or captivated by pharaohs, these engaging stories will bring the wonders of Ancient Egypt to life. Encourage your little ones to dive into the past and explore the rich history and culture of this remarkable civilization.
